Output 21528cd0c2468fddd38d1c2adc59d477ed1c879f42500941a0bbc20f9ac35c6a:3

value
23453104
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ed37437469c4d760d4ab48eba04f685276770d28 OP_EQUAL
address
MVXSafkc27vKegWtKe6ktWEjfiMSvi5qkH
transaction
21528cd0c2468fddd38d1c2adc59d477ed1c879f42500941a0bbc20f9ac35c6a
spent
true